  • Michigan State University (MSU) offers a Master of Science in Accounting (MSA) program, which is designed to provide students with advanced knowledge and skills in accounting and related areas.
  • The program aims to prepare students for careers in public accounting, corporate accounting, financial management, consulting, or other accounting-related fields.
  • The MSA program at MSU offers a comprehensive curriculum that covers a broad range of accounting topics, including financial accounting, managerial accounting, taxation, auditing, and accounting information systems.
  • The coursework combines theoretical knowledge with practical applications to develop students' technical expertise and critical thinking skills.
